The Studio

Firemonkeys, Electronic Arts' leading mobile games studio, located in Melbourne, Australia, is home to the preeminent Sims experience on mobile, The Sims FreePlay. Summary

We are looking for a Senior Product Manager reporting to the Director of Product to define, market, and support Sims FreePlay. You will work closely with our development teams and stakeholders to understand the market, identify opportunities, and provide analytics insights  for our live operations. You will also be responsible for prioritizing product features, managing the product backlog, and ensuring that the team is working on the most impactful tasks. This is a strategic, metrics-driven role focusing on the game’s user acquisition, engagement, and monetization crucial to delivering engaging and viral features that are fun, iconic, and meet our revenue goals.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including design, development, and marketing, to provide new experiences and features to our players

  • Maximize titles' acquisition, engagement, monetization, and of course, fun!

  • Act as a liaison between the stakeholders and the development team, ensuring clear communication

  • Lead the planning of product release plans and set expectations for delivery of new functionalities

  • Oversee the development stages, ensuring the final product meets the defined requirements

  • Develop and maintain an appropriately prioritized backlog of user stories for implementation

  • Analyse games industry market trends and competitor strategies

  • Manage virtual economies and economy models

  • Use analytics and quantitative analysis to monitor game performance, tune mechanics, and identify new opportunities and features to improve user conversion, retention, and monetization

  • Coordinate with marketing, creative, and franchise teams to promote titles both in-game and externally to optimize response/ROI

  • Work with Director of Product in business planning and KPI setting for the team
